Output 95dcdc610f8e21282a24dc925f7065283b46f4064f0a8d3f9ccad9a837bd76b1:39

value
107328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 623a7f74b7acee8c4b80a348841dfcd108d0798b OP_EQUAL
address
3AeQDr4e2dedEMmeVRWLix5EEu48VgmQP8
transaction
95dcdc610f8e21282a24dc925f7065283b46f4064f0a8d3f9ccad9a837bd76b1
confirmations
248764
spent
true